£597,210 per year

Based on an annual salary of £597,210, your estimated take home pay is £330,822 after tax and National Insurance, giving you £27,568 per month

Yearly Monthly Weekly Daily
Basic Salary £597,210.00 £49,767.50 £11,484.81 £2,296.96
Taxable Income £597,210.00 £49,767.50 £11,484.81 £2,296.96
Income Tax £252,433.50 £21,036.13 £4,854.49 £970.90
National Insurance £13,954.80 £1,162.90 £268.36 £53.67
Take Home Pay £330,821.70 £27,568.48 £6,361.96 £1,272.39
Calculation Assumptions

To give you an idea of what you'd bring home after taxes, we based our calculations on these assumptions:

  • You are an employee, not a company director.
  • You don't get paid dividends (a share of company profits).
  • Your salary is spread out in equal payments throughout the year.
  • You haven't reached retirement age yet and don't receive a state pension.
  • You don't pay Scottish income tax (this applies to people in Scotland).
  • Your National Insurance (NI) category is A, H & M (this is a standard category for most employees).
  • You only pay Class 1 National Insurance (this is paid by most employees).
  • Your tax code is likely 1257L, which is typical for someone with one job or pension.
  • This information about your take-home pay doesn't include any money going towards a pension.
